Duke Energy has appealed a $6.8 million fine levied by North Carolina for the catastrophic Dan River coal ash spill, calling the penalty “entirely arbitrary and capricious.” The company said the state Department of Environmental Quality raised the fine “to a newsworthy amount” after the Dan River spill attracted media...
